Associated papers

Three stapled sheets of typewritten paper include William Meldrum's brief biography and descriptions of two specific works. It also includes the custodial histories of the paintings: they were presented to the Glasgow Corporation in April 1966, after Meldrum's death. The final sheet illustrates a simple drawing of Glasgow street map, indicating where Meldrum may have depicted the view of Glasgow in the 1900s.

The description specifically details two undated watercolour landscape paintings titled "Cumbernauld Road at Riddrie, Glasgow." These paintings depict the same location, each viewed in the summer and winter.

The two associated paintings are currently in storage at Glasgow Museums Resources Centre.

Papers and photographs of William Meldrum, artist, student at The Glasgow School of Art, Scotland

  • DC 120
  • Collection
  • c1880s-1970s

A number of sketches and photographs of works by William Meldrum. This collection includes figure and illustrative drawings, unique pieces made of seaweed, and a series of monochrome photographs featuring landscape paintings. Most of the items are undated however the dates of creation are presumed to fall between the 1880s and 1920s. A set of typewritten paper by an unknown author dated after 1966, features a brief biography of Meldrum and descriptions of two drawings along with their custodial histories.

William Meldrum tended to work on depicting city views of Glasgow in the early 20th century and landscapes of diverse areas in Scotland. He created multiple pieces of black-and-white photographs on which his paintings have been printed; some of the photographs have identical versions.
